Solution Overview

Problem

Existing systems face challenges in efficiently managing and retrieving relevant data from diverse sources to perform natural language tasks, leading to issues like data fragmentation, resource costs, and the need for custom data retrieval solutions.

Innovation Solution

The implementation of distributed orchestration of natural language tasks using a generative machine learning model, which allows for customized retrieval from various resources, optimizes data usage, and improves the performance of generative machine learning systems by coordinating data retrieval and accessing relevant data.

1Quantity of substance

If data is stored across many different systems or services, then information capacity and storage flexibility are improved, but data retrieval complexity and time increase

Engineering Contradiction:
Improveinformation capacityVSAvoiddata retrieval time
Core Design Contradiction:
Quantity of substanceVSLoss of time

Solution Approach 1:

The system segments data retrieval operations by maintaining separate data repositories for different data types (e.g., knowledge base, codebase, documentation) and uses specialized retrievers for each repository. This allows parallel retrieval operations across multiple data sources simultaneously, reducing overall retrieval time while maintaining the benefits of distributed storage.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#1Segmentation

Solution Approach 2:

The patent introduces a retrieval configuration and orchestration layer that acts as an intermediary between natural language queries and multiple data repositories. This intermediary coordinates retrieval operations across different systems, manages context windows, and synthesizes results, thereby reducing the time penalty of accessing distributed data.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#24Intermediary (Mediator)

2Measurement precision

If custom data retrieval solutions are implemented for each system, then data access precision is improved, but system complexity and expertise requirements increase

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vedata access precisionVSAvoidsystem complexity
Core Design Contradiction:
Measurement precisionVSDevice complexity

Solution Approach 1:

The patent implements a universal retrieval configuration system that can access multiple different data repositories (knowledge bases, codebases, documentation systems) through a unified interface. The same orchestration framework handles diverse data types and retrieval patterns, eliminating the need for separate custom retrieval solutions for each system while maintaining precise data access.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#6Universality (Multi-functionality)

Solution Approach 2:

The system uses parameterized retrieval configurations where data access precision is controlled through configurable parameters (e.g., context window size, retrieval thresholds, filtering criteria) rather than custom-coded solutions. This allows precise data retrieval across different repositories by adjusting parameters rather than implementing complex custom logic.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#35Parameter changes

3Adaptability or versatility

If generative machine learning models are used for natural language tasks, then task versatility is improved, but resource consumption and costs increase

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vetask versatilityVSAvoidresource consumption
Core Design Contradiction:
Adaptability or versatilityVSUse of energy by moving object

Solution Approach 1:

The patent applies partial retrieval and selective prompting to generative models, where only the most relevant data portions are retrieved and included in the context window rather than providing all available data. This reduces the computational resources required for processing while maintaining high task versatility through the generative model's ability to handle diverse natural language queries.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#16Partial or excessive action

Solution Approach 2:

The system performs preliminary data retrieval and filtering before generating responses, pre-organizing data into context windows and caching frequently accessed information. This preliminary action reduces the computational burden on generative models during the actual generation process, lowering resource consumption while preserving the model's versatility for various natural language tasks.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#10Preliminary action

Data Source

PatentUS20250110979A1Distributed orchestration of natural language tasks using a generate machine learning model
Publication Date: 2025.04.03 AMAZON TECH INC

AI summary

Distributed orchestration of data retrieval for generative machine learning model may be performed. When a natural language request to perform a natural language task is received that is associated with a generative application, one or more data retrievers may be selected to access associated data repositories according to a previously specified retrieval configuration for the generative natural language application. The data may then be obtained by the selected data retrievers and used to generate a prompt to a generative machine learning model. A result of the generative machine learning model may then be used to provide a response to the natural language request to perform the natural language task.
